Diving into Executive Condominiums

Executive condominiums (ECs) offer a middle ground between HDB flats and private condominiums. Targeted primarily at first-time buyers and young families, ECs come with restrictions on resale but provide premium features at a lower price point compared to private options. Over the years, ECs have evolved to include luxury amenities, making them an attractive choice for many.

HDB Developments vs. Private Housing

Purchasing a home in Singapore often leads buyers to choose between HDB developments and private housing. HDB flats are more affordable and subsidized by the government, making them ideal for budget-conscious buyers. In contrast, private properties usually command higher prices but offer greater flexibility, including no restrictions on occupancy or resale. Each option has its pros and cons, and understanding these differences is crucial for a successful investment.

Legal Aspects to Consider When Buying

Navigating the legalities of property purchase in Singapore is paramount. Buyers should be well-versed in the Sale and Purchase Agreement, which outlines the terms of the transaction. It is also advisable to secure legal representation to review documents and address any arising concerns. Understanding potential fees such as stamp duties and legal fees is equally important to avoid unpleasant surprises later in the process.
